117.info
人生若只如初见

Debian Strings如何优化网络连接

在Debian系统中,优化网络连接可以通过多种方法实现,具体步骤如下:

1. 查看和启动网络接口

首先,使用以下命令查看网络接口的启动情况和网络连接状态:

$ sudo ip link show

如果无线网卡未启动,可以使用以下命令启动它:

$ sudo ip link set dev wlp4s0 up

2. 安装必要的工具

确保已安装 iw 无线工具包和 netplanNetworkManager,这些工具可以帮助管理无线网络连接。

$ sudo apt update
$ sudo apt install iw
$ sudo apt install netplan.io  # 或者 sudo apt install networkmanager

3. 配置静态IP地址(使用netplan)

如果需要配置静态IP地址,可以创建和编辑 /etc/netplan/01netcfg.yaml 文件:

$ sudo nano /etc/netplan/01netcfg.yaml

在文件中输入以下内容,根据实际情况修改IP地址、子网掩码、网关和DNS服务器地址:

network:
  version: 2
  renderer: networkd
  ethernets:
    eth0:
      dhcp4: no
      addresses: [192.168.1.100/24]
      gateway4: 192.168.1.1
      nameservers:
        addresses: [8.8.8.8, 8.8.4.4]

保存文件后,应用配置:

$ sudo netplan apply

4. 配置动态IP地址(使用NetworkManager)

如果需要配置动态IP地址,可以安装并启用 NetworkManager

$ sudo apt install networkmanager
$ sudo systemctl enable NetworkManager
$ sudo systemctl start NetworkManager

然后,右键点击屏幕右上角的网络图标,选择“编辑连接”,在弹出的窗口中选择“以太网”或“无线”作为连接类型,配置自动分配IP地址(DHCP)或手动设置IP地址。

5. 重启网络服务

无论使用哪种方式配置网络连接,最后都需要重启网络服务以使配置生效:

$ sudo systemctl restart networking

6. 配置无线网络连接

对于无线网络连接,可以编辑 /etc/network/interfaces 文件或使用 wpa_supplicant 配置文件:

$ sudo nano /etc/network/interfaces

添加以下内容:

auto wlan0
iface wlan0 inet dhcp
wpa-conf /etc/wpa_supplicant/wireless.conf

创建 /etc/wpa_supplicant/wireless.conf 文件,添加以下内容:

wpa-ssid your_essid
wpa-psk your_password

重启网络服务:

$ sudo /etc/init.d/networking restart

7. 检查网络连接

使用以下命令检查网络连接状态:

$ ip link show
$ ip addr show
$ ping google.com

通过以上步骤,您可以优化Debian系统的网络连接。如果遇到问题,请检查网络接口是否启用,IP地址、子网掩码、默认网关和DNS服务器配置是否正确,以及防火墙规则是否阻止了网络连接。

未经允许不得转载 » 本文链接:https://www.117.info/ask/fe82cAzsNAAFUAV0.html

推荐文章

  • Debian PostgreSQL网络配置要点

    在Debian系统上配置PostgreSQL时,网络配置是一个重要的步骤。以下是Debian PostgreSQL网络配置的要点: 修改PostgreSQL配置文件: postgresql.conf:修改listen...

  • Debian Context的网络设置怎么配置

    在Debian系统中配置网络设置有多种方法,以下是一些常见的方法:
    使用 /etc/network/interfaces 文件进行配置
    这是最传统的方法,适用于大多数Debian版...

  • debian软连接在哪创建

    在Debian系统中,创建软连接(也称为符号链接)的步骤如下:
    方法一:使用ln命令 打开终端: 你可以通过快捷键 Ctrl + Alt + T 打开终端。 导航到目标目录:...

  • GitLab在Debian上的日志如何查看与分析

    在Debian系统上查看和分析GitLab日志,可以按照以下步骤进行:
    查看GitLab日志 使用 gitlab-ctl 命令: gitlab-ctl tail 命令可以实时查看GitLab的所有日志...

  • OpenSSL如何生成私钥

    使用 OpenSSL 生成私钥是一个相对简单的过程。以下是生成不同类型私钥的步骤:
    生成 RSA 私钥 打开终端或命令提示符。 输入以下命令来生成一个 2048 位的 R...

  • CentOS下VirtualBox如何调整分辨率

    在CentOS下使用VirtualBox调整分辨率的步骤如下: 安装增强功能: 打开VirtualBox,选择你的CentOS虚拟机,点击“设备”菜单,然后选择“安装增强功能”。
    ...

  • 怎样用Telnet测试Linux端口是否开放

    使用Telnet测试Linux端口是否开放,可以按照以下步骤进行:
    方法一:通过命令行使用Telnet 打开终端: 在Linux系统中,可以通过快捷键Ctrl + Alt + T打开终...

  • Ubuntu SSH如何监控连接状态

    在Ubuntu系统中,您可以使用以下方法来监控SSH连接状态: 使用who命令: who命令可以显示当前登录到系统的用户及其相关信息,包括SSH连接。在终端中输入以下命令...